Can the Marcos-Duterte govt survive its internal conflicts?

I RAISE this question as a former government spokesman, probably the longest serving one on record. I am beginning to suspect, and I hope I am completely wrong, that the basic problem of government is one of communication.

We are not hearing enough of the right things from the government, and no one other than the President, who is not always there, is speaking for it. This problem must be immediately and earnestly addressed.
